Scholars from the PSU Institute of Law spoke at an international conference in Kazakhstan

31.10.2025 14:59

On Thursday, October 23, representatives of the Institute of Law of Penza State University participated in the International Scientific and Practical Conference "The Declaration of State Sovereignty and Modern Kazakhstan: Challenges, Achievements, and Horizons of Sustainable Development," dedicated to the 35th anniversary of the Declaration of State Sovereignty and Republic Day of Kazakhstan.

The scientific event was organized by Al-Farabi Kazakh National University.

The large-scale event brought together prominent scholars, government and public figures, the university administration, teaching staff, and students.

At the plenary session, participants presented reports on the history and contemporary development of Kazakhstan's statehood, sovereignty, political system, and socioeconomic and legal reforms.

Nikolay Svechnikov, Head of the Department of Law Enforcement at Penza State University, delivered a welcoming address to the conference participants. Evgenia Kazakova, Head of the Department of Private and Public Law, Olga Ryzhova, Head of the Department of Criminal Law, and Natalia Makeeva, Associate Professor of the Department of Theory of State, Law, and Political Studies, participated in discussions on a number of topical issues raised in the presentations.

Erkin Duseynov, Deputy Chairman of the Board and First Vice-Rector of Al-Farabi Kazakh National University, Doctor of Law, Professor, and conference moderator, thanked his Penza colleagues and expressed hope for further fruitful cooperation.

The conference continued with breakout sessions, where topics such as "Constitutional and Legal Development of Kazakhstan as a Sovereign State," "State Sovereignty as a Value: An Interdisciplinary Approach to Challenges and Prospects," "Economic Policy and Constitutional Principles of Sustainable Development," and others were discussed.

Participation in the conference was a result of the Memorandum and agreements on creative cooperation concluded between PSU and Al-Farabi Kazakh National University, Turan University, and Kunaev University.
